Whether you are the pull-out-the-stops die hard holiday fanatic, or the DIY cut-and-paste card maker, or the one scoffing at the spectacle of it all, you can head down to the Trout Lake School and enjoy the first Trout Lake Care community meal. Doors open at 4 p.m. and the meal will be held at 5 p.m. in the school's cafeteria. There will be live music to sweeten your sweetheart. There is a suggested donation of $3.50 for those 60 and over (and their spouses), and $6.50 for those under 60. Those who cannot afford the donation are encouraged to attend as well. If all goes well, TLC plans to make these community meals a monthly event. The Trout Lake Community Council is looking into funding that would allow a feasibility study of downtown sewer system. Anyone interested in learning more is encouraged to attend the March 6 community council meeting.
